Velly
52 rue Lamartine, 9ème
A local bistro can be just the place
for a tête-à-tête. In this time-worn
dining room, the updated bistro
food is a sensual pleasure. (See p45)
Au Pied de Cochon
6 rue Coquillière, 1er
Don't be put off by the name - this
buzzy round-the-clock spot does
serve pig's feet, but there's also less
challenging fare on offer. (See p24)
Chez Vong
10 rue de la Grande Truanderie, 1er
In a city where convincing Chinese
cuisine is all too rare, Chez Vong is
a real find, with tasteful decor and
stunning food. (See p25)
L'Ambroisie
9 place des Vosges, 4ème
Posh frocks and suave suits
are de rigueur at this elegant
restaurant, with its exquisite setting
and luxury food. (See p29)
La Tour de Montlhéry
5 rue des Prouvaires, 1er
A remnant of Les Halles' market
days, this is a great spot for a vast
steak in the small hours. (See p25)
Abazu
3 rue André-Mazet, 6ème
Freshness is key at this Japanese
restaurant, where Parisians go to
chill out and enjoy the theatrical
teppanaki experience. (See p34)
Fogon St-Julien
10 rue St-Julien-le-Pauvre, 5ème
Find first-class Spanish food at this
address near Notre Dame. Their six
different paellas will have you stamp-
ing your feet for more. (See p32)
Le Souk
1 rue Keller, 11ème
Less extravagant than a trip to
Morocco, Le Souk is just as exotic,
with its spiced tagines, mood light-
ing and attentive service. (See p51)
Sardegna a Tavola
1 rue de Cotte, 12ème
This sunny Sardinian restaurant has
established itself as the best of its
kind in Paris, thanks to the quality of
its ingredients and cooking. (See p52)
Brasseries are a good choice for a
late dinner; most remain open until
midnight or later.
Aux Lyonnais
32 rue St-Marc, 2ème
This traditional bistro with vintage
decor, charming service and fragrant
Lyonnais food will deliver a perfect
Paris moment. (See p25)
L'As du Fallafel
34 rue des Rosiers, 4ème
There are falafal joints galore on this
street, but few can match this one.
“Often imitated, never equalled ,
says the sign. (See p29)
